36/1572 = ≈2.29%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A fraction like 36/1572 can describe a small share of a larger group, such as 36 defective items in a shipment of 1,572 or 36 students in a much larger school population. In percentage terms, that is about 2.29%, so it represents a fairly uncommon result.
To picture it quickly, imagine 100 equal spots with only about 2 of them shaded, plus a small extra portion. You can also think of it as roughly 2 out of every 100, which makes the size easier to estimate at a glance.
A common mistake is to read 2.29% as 2.29 whole items or 2.29 people. A percentage describes a portion of the total, so the actual number represented depends on the size of the group.
